Who Was Neil Simon?
Born Marvin Neil Simon on July 4, 1927, in the Bronx, New York, Neil Simon's journey to becoming a celebrated playwright is a classic story of talent meeting opportunity. Simon's works are known for their wit, humor, and poignant exploration of human relationships. Some of his most famous plays include "The Odd Couple," "Barefoot in the Park," and "Brighton Beach Memoirs."

Estimating Neil Simon's Net Worth
While an exact figure is difficult to ascertain, Neil Simon's net worth at the time of his death in 2018 was estimated to be around $75 million. This substantial wealth reflects his prolific output and the enduring popularity of his work.
